Output 5189de8d556e121acb9287ad9a99863cc32f485614610dfb7fa0460a88779d4b:1

value
15313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e11fc267bffc54844bf3ad056ae0fff620999789 OP_EQUAL
address
3NDN1PQRb5m8hi63nrCSy24C5Q1ySo3EnC
transaction
5189de8d556e121acb9287ad9a99863cc32f485614610dfb7fa0460a88779d4b
confirmations
286518
spent
true